Webgame, Discovery Learning, Mathematics Learning, Learning Media, Learning OutcomesAbstract
This study aims to analyze the needs for developing webgame-based learning media integrated with the Discovery Learning model to improve students’ motivation and mathematics learning outcomes at the junior high school level. The research employed a Research and Development (R&D) approach using the ADDIE model, focusing on the analysis stage. The subjects of the study consisted of 31 junior high school students and three mathematics teachers. Data were collected through questionnaires and interviews. The questionnaire instrument consisted of 20 statements covering aspects of learning motivation, mathematics learning difficulties, the use of learning media, interest in educational games, and the need for webgame-based learning media. Instrument validity was tested using Corrected Item–Total Correlation, while reliability testing used Cronbach’s Alpha. The results showed that 17 out of 20 items were valid, and the reliability coefficient reached 0.87, indicating high reliability. Qualitative findings revealed that mathematics learning was still dominated by conventional teacher-centered methods, causing students to become passive and less motivated in the learning process. Students showed a high interest in interactive learning using webgames. In addition, teachers supported the development of webgame-based learning media integrated with the Discovery Learning model to create a more engaging, interactive, and meaningful learning environment.
